Transaction 72a4962bbbd652fae25ade8ed3714b546d094f1bde9a55e8359dae23f24dfc56

1 Input
2 Outputs
  • 72a4962bbbd652fae25ade8ed3714b546d094f1bde9a55e8359dae23f24dfc56:0
  • value  100000000
    address  3Ji9v8GpKzwYpc3orArGYzFAiNNY9bqYmy
  • 72a4962bbbd652fae25ade8ed3714b546d094f1bde9a55e8359dae23f24dfc56:1
  • value  522985638
    address  3F1TBRyTxvr3kyBoTVtY7CFE8YyBESavoG